A leading catering services company is seeking a Catering Assistant for Wateringbury School in East Malling. This role involves providing food service and preparation tasks during term time, offering a flexible 15-hour work week from Monday to Friday.
The successful candidate will ensure compliance with health and safety standards while delivering friendly service to students and staff. A commitment to safeguarding and an enhanced DBS disclosure are required for this position.
